IIPL-INDIA INDIA TATA LONDON PROJECTS LTD. - DELHI

Excellent Good Average Poor Bad

Investment Projects in Delhi

Tristaar Construction Consortium

Shop No - C - 7, Kailash Colony,, Delhi - 110048, Delhi, India

Barka Properties

A-6, Najafgarh Road, Dwarka,, Delhi - 110059, Delhi, India

Venus Buildtech India Pvt. Ltd.

Dmrc Casting Yard , Road No-51 ,mukund Pur , Near Azad Pur,, Delhi - 110034, Delhi, India

Shri Ram Associates

30/11, Shop No- 7 Gf, Shakti Nagar,, Delhi - 110007, Delhi, India

Firstouch Solutions Pvt. Ltd.

Suit Number- S/16, Star City Mall, Mayur Vihar Extension, Near Mayur Vihar Extension Metro Station,, Delhi - 110091, Delhi, India

Share this page on Facebook Twitter Google Digg Reddit LinkedIn Pinterest StumbleUpon Email